Searched defs:proc_num (Results 1 - 7 of 7) sorted by relevance
/device/linaro/bootloader/arm-trusted-firmware/drivers/arm/gic/v3/ |
H A D | gic500.c | 13 void gicv3_distif_pre_save(unsigned int proc_num) argument 15 arm_gicv3_distif_pre_save(proc_num); 18 void gicv3_distif_post_restore(unsigned int proc_num) argument 20 arm_gicv3_distif_post_restore(proc_num);
|
H A D | gic600.c | 82 void gicv3_distif_pre_save(unsigned int proc_num) argument 84 arm_gicv3_distif_pre_save(proc_num); 87 void gicv3_distif_post_restore(unsigned int proc_num) argument 89 arm_gicv3_distif_post_restore(proc_num); 95 void gicv3_rdistif_off(unsigned int proc_num) argument 100 assert(proc_num < gicv3_driver_data->rdistif_num); 103 gicr_base = gicv3_driver_data->rdistif_base_addrs[proc_num]; 113 void gicv3_rdistif_on(unsigned int proc_num) argument 118 assert(proc_num < gicv3_driver_data->rdistif_num); 121 gicr_base = gicv3_driver_data->rdistif_base_addrs[proc_num]; [all...] |
H A D | gicv3_helpers.c | 308 unsigned int proc_num; local 325 proc_num = mpidr_to_core_pos(mpidr); 327 proc_num = (typer_val >> TYPER_PROC_NUM_SHIFT) & 330 assert(proc_num < rdistif_num); 331 rdistif_base_addrs[proc_num] = rdistif_base;
|
H A D | gicv3_main.c | 221 * (identified by the 'proc_num' parameter) based upon the data provided by the 224 void gicv3_rdistif_init(unsigned int proc_num) argument 229 assert(proc_num < gicv3_driver_data->rdistif_num); 237 gicv3_rdistif_on(proc_num); 239 gicr_base = gicv3_driver_data->rdistif_base_addrs[proc_num]; 277 void gicv3_rdistif_off(unsigned int proc_num) argument 282 void gicv3_rdistif_on(unsigned int proc_num) argument 291 void gicv3_cpuif_enable(unsigned int proc_num) argument 298 assert(proc_num < gicv3_driver_data->rdistif_num); 303 gicr_base = gicv3_driver_data->rdistif_base_addrs[proc_num]; 353 gicv3_cpuif_disable(unsigned int proc_num) argument 430 gicv3_get_interrupt_type(unsigned int id, unsigned int proc_num) argument 545 gicv3_rdistif_save(unsigned int proc_num, gicv3_redist_ctx_t * const rdist_ctx) argument 599 gicv3_rdistif_init_restore(unsigned int proc_num, const gicv3_redist_ctx_t * const rdist_ctx) argument 830 gicv3_get_interrupt_active(unsigned int id, unsigned int proc_num) argument 856 gicv3_enable_interrupt(unsigned int id, unsigned int proc_num) argument 884 gicv3_disable_interrupt(unsigned int id, unsigned int proc_num) argument 919 gicv3_set_interrupt_priority(unsigned int id, unsigned int proc_num, unsigned int priority) argument 943 gicv3_set_interrupt_type(unsigned int id, unsigned int proc_num, unsigned int type) argument 1080 gicv3_clear_interrupt_pending(unsigned int id, unsigned int proc_num) argument 1106 gicv3_set_interrupt_pending(unsigned int id, unsigned int proc_num) argument [all...] |
/device/linaro/bootloader/arm-trusted-firmware/drivers/arm/gic/v2/ |
H A D | gicv2_main.c | 299 void gicv2_set_pe_target_mask(unsigned int proc_num) argument 304 assert(proc_num < GICV2_MAX_TARGET_PE); 305 assert(proc_num < driver_data->target_masks_num); 308 if (driver_data->target_masks[proc_num]) 312 driver_data->target_masks[proc_num] = 404 * The proc_num parameter must be the linear index of the target PE in the 407 void gicv2_raise_sgi(int sgi_num, int proc_num) argument 412 assert(proc_num < GICV2_MAX_TARGET_PE); 420 assert(proc_num < driver_data->target_masks_num); 423 target = driver_data->target_masks[proc_num]; 442 gicv2_set_spi_routing(unsigned int id, int proc_num) argument [all...] |
/device/linaro/bootloader/arm-trusted-firmware/plat/arm/board/fvp/ |
H A D | fvp_pm.c | 76 void arm_gicv3_distif_pre_save(unsigned int proc_num) argument 79 void arm_gicv3_distif_post_restore(unsigned int proc_num) argument
|
/device/linaro/bootloader/arm-trusted-firmware/plat/common/ |
H A D | plat_gicv2.c | 248 int proc_num = 0; local 252 proc_num = plat_core_pos_by_mpidr(mpidr); 253 assert(proc_num >= 0); 257 proc_num = -1; 263 gicv2_set_spi_routing(id, proc_num);
|
Completed in 31 milliseconds